Voyage to the South Pacific, Sept. 2003 - July 2004

In September of 2003, I left the San Francisco Bay Area to become a crew member of the RV Heraclitus, run by the Planetary Coral Reef Foundation (PCRF). I boarded the ship in Seattle and sailed down the west coast of the US, into Mexico, and then across the Pacific Ocean to French Polynesia. We spent three months voyaging between seven of the polynesian islands - Rangiroa, Tikehau, Tahiti, Huahine, Raiatea, Tahaa, and Bora Bora.

My time at sea was transformative, but impossible to convey. I highly recommend taking time to sail if you can. For now, enjoy the photos! There are more where these came from...
